SLAB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2018 in Review

249 of the 4,368 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Silicon Laboratories (SLAB) for Q2 2018, worth a combined $4B — up 13% from $3.54B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 25 funds closed out of SLAB and 24 opened new positions — a net loss of 1 holder — while 86 trimmed existing stakes and 99 added.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$58.8M. The largest seller was Wellington Management Group, cutting an estimated $29.8M.
